Lumbrokinase

Lumbrokinase is a science topic covered in the lgStudy science library. This page brings together a partial reference excerpt, illustrations, worked examples, real-world applications and a short study plan, so you can understand Lumbrokinase rather than just read about it. In short: Lumbrokinase is a class of fibrinolytic enzymes present in earthworm species including Lumbricus bimastus and Lumbricus rubellus. This enzyme was first discovered in 1991 in earthworm saliva.
